Strategic Development Committee

Strategic Development Committee - Wednesday, 3rd April, 2024 5.30 p.m.

The council meeting focused on reviewing a strategic development application for the former News International site, now proposed for redevelopment into residential and commercial spaces. The committee unanimously approved the application, which includes significant provisions for affordable housing and a logistics wharf pre-application presentation.
